    Doctored Cake Mix

    Need other ideas to make boxed cake mix taste like bakery cake? I have tested recipes for chocolate cake, carrot cake, red velvet cake, strawberry cake, white cake and yellow cake to name a few!

    You can use my basic recipe for boxed cake mix recipes but you can add so many different ingredients to make boxed cake mix better depending on the type of cake you are making. For example:

    • Chocolate: Swap coffee for water to make a chocolate espresso cake and add chocolate chips!
    • Carrot: Add in shredded carrot and coconut for a boxed carrot cake.
    • Red Velvet: Add in a dash of cocoa powder and white chocolate chips.
    • Strawberry: Add diced strawberries.
    • White or Yellow: Add in nuts or funfetti sprinkles! You can also add lemon or orange zest and mix up your frosting!
    • Other ideas: Chopped nuts, almond or vanilla extract, soda or jam! Also, adding sour cream, mayo or pudding mix can add a different dimension to your recipe.

    Can you make with almond milk or other alternative milks?

    Yes. You can make boxed cake mix recipes with almond milk, oat milk, soy milk, whole milk, 2% milk, 1% milk, fat free milk, half and half or heavy cream!

    How to Improve Boxed Cake Mix: Doctored Cake Mix Hacks!

    How to improve boxed cake mix! Adding different options to make boxed cake mix recipes is easy and fun! Hack that cupcake or cake!
    5 from 145 votes
    Print Pin Rate
    Course: Dessert
    Cuisine: American
    Prep Time: 5 minutes
    Cook Time: 12 minutes
    Total Time: 17 minutes
    Servings: 24 people
    Calories: 120kcal
    Author: Aubrey

    Equipment

    • cake pan, cupcake pan

    Ingredients

    • 1 15-16 oz box cake mix Betty Crocker, Pillsbury or box mix of choice.
    • 5 eggs 4 whole eggs and 1 egg yolk
    • 1 cup whole milk (or alternative milk of choice)
    • ⅔ cup melted butter

    Instructions

    • Follow box instructions.
    • Note: For cupcakes, I cooked LESS than box instructions, 12 minutes.
